BMW Motorrad and Dainese recently announced that they will be working together to develop motorcycle safety clothing for BMW Motorrad that includes the Dainese D-Air Protect System with fully integrated inflatable protectors.
The first product, the DoubleR RaceAir one-piece leather suit with D-Air racing protectors, is being designed exclusively for use on the track. It is scheduled to be presented at the international EICMA motorcycle show in Milan this November, once BMW Motorrad has completed all the required testing in Munich.
A Dainese D-Air Street System will follow in 2015 as a retrofit solution for BMW Motorrad. BMW Motorrad customers will then be able to retrofit this safety system to their motorcycles and apparel.
BMW Motorrad has developed a complete range of rider equipment ever since the 1970s—from motorcycle helmets to rider suits, boots, gloves and the Neck Brace System, which was introduced in 2007.
